The catalog you build, not the one you license

The compatibility feeds you can buy are built around late-model cars and current trucks — that's where the data companies see the volume. The rest of the parts world is on you. Here's the angle: the catalog you build on your own teardowns is worth more for your shelves than any catalog you license.
